
财务分析使用软件开发的关键在于:数据采集、数据处理、数据可视化、自动化分析。 其中,数据可视化是最为关键的一点。数据可视化通过将复杂的数据转化为图表、仪表盘等直观形式,帮助财务人员快速发现数据背后的趋势和问题。FineBI作为帆软旗下的专业BI工具,提供了强大的数据可视化功能,通过简单的拖拽操作即可生成各种图表,并支持多维度的交互分析,大大提高了财务分析的效率和准确性。
一、数据采集
数据采集是财务分析的第一步,涉及从各种数据源获取原始数据。企业的财务数据通常分散在多个系统中,如ERP、CRM、Excel等。为了进行有效的财务分析,必须将这些数据整合到一个统一的平台上。FineBI提供了丰富的数据连接器,支持与多种数据源的无缝对接,包括关系型数据库、云端数据源、API等。通过FineBI,用户可以轻松导入和整合不同来源的数据,实现数据的统一管理和分析。
数据采集过程中需要注意数据的完整性和准确性。数据缺失或错误会导致分析结果失真,影响决策的准确性。FineBI通过内置的数据清洗工具,可以自动检测和修复数据中的问题,确保数据的高质量。同时,FineBI支持定时任务功能,可以定期自动采集和更新数据,保证分析数据的实时性。
二、数据处理
数据处理是将原始数据转换为可分析的数据结构的过程。包括数据清洗、数据转换和数据聚合等步骤。FineBI提供了强大的数据处理功能,支持多种数据处理操作,如数据过滤、数据排序、数据分组等。通过这些操作,用户可以将原始数据转化为符合分析需求的格式,提高数据分析的效率和准确性。
FineBI还支持自定义计算字段和指标,用户可以根据业务需求创建新的计算字段和指标,满足复杂的财务分析需求。例如,可以通过自定义计算字段计算毛利率、净利润率等财务指标,为财务分析提供更多的参考依据。同时,FineBI支持多维度的数据透视分析,可以从不同的角度对数据进行深入分析,帮助用户发现数据背后的趋势和问题。
三、数据可视化
数据可视化是财务分析的关键环节,通过将数据转化为图表、仪表盘等直观形式,帮助财务人员快速发现数据背后的趋势和问题。FineBI提供了丰富的数据可视化组件,包括柱状图、折线图、饼图、雷达图等,用户可以根据分析需求选择合适的图表类型。同时,FineBI支持多维度的交互分析,用户可以通过点击、拖拽等操作,实时调整分析维度和指标,深入挖掘数据价值。
FineBI的数据可视化功能不仅支持静态图表,还支持动态图表和实时监控。 用户可以通过FineBI创建实时监控仪表盘,实时监控财务数据的变化情况,及时发现和应对异常情况。例如,可以创建一个实时监控仪表盘,实时监控企业的现金流、应收账款、应付账款等关键财务指标,帮助企业及时发现和解决资金链问题。
四、自动化分析
自动化分析是利用机器学习和人工智能技术,自动分析和预测数据趋势的过程。FineBI通过内置的智能分析引擎,支持多种自动化分析功能,如异常检测、趋势预测、关联分析等。用户只需简单配置,即可实现数据的自动化分析和预测,提高分析效率和准确性。
FineBI的自动化分析功能不仅支持单一数据源的分析,还支持多数据源的联合分析。 用户可以通过FineBI将多个数据源的数据整合在一起,进行联合分析,发现数据之间的关联和规律。例如,可以通过FineBI将销售数据和财务数据整合在一起,分析销售业绩对财务状况的影响,帮助企业制定更加科学的销售和财务策略。
五、应用场景
财务分析的应用场景非常广泛,包括预算管理、成本控制、盈利分析、风险管理等。FineBI作为专业的BI工具,可以应用于各种财务分析场景,帮助企业提高财务管理水平和决策能力。
在预算管理方面,FineBI可以帮助企业制定和监控预算,分析预算执行情况,发现预算偏差,及时调整预算策略。例如,可以通过FineBI创建预算监控仪表盘,实时监控各部门的预算执行情况,发现和解决预算超支问题。
在成本控制方面,FineBI可以帮助企业分析成本构成,发现成本控制的薄弱环节,制定和实施成本控制措施。例如,可以通过FineBI创建成本分析仪表盘,分析各项成本的构成和变化情况,发现和解决成本超支问题,提高企业的成本控制能力。
在盈利分析方面,FineBI可以帮助企业分析盈利能力,发现盈利增长的驱动因素,制定和实施盈利增长策略。例如,可以通过FineBI创建盈利分析仪表盘,分析各产品线、各区域的盈利情况,发现和解决盈利问题,提高企业的盈利能力。
在风险管理方面,FineBI可以帮助企业识别和评估财务风险,制定和实施风险应对措施。例如,可以通过FineBI创建风险监控仪表盘,实时监控财务风险指标,发现和解决财务风险问题,提高企业的风险管理能力。
六、案例分析
为了更好地理解FineBI在财务分析中的应用,我们可以通过一个实际案例来进行分析。假设某企业希望通过FineBI进行全面的财务分析,以提高财务管理水平和决策能力。
首先,企业通过FineBI的数据连接器,将ERP、CRM、Excel等系统中的数据导入到FineBI中,实现数据的统一管理。然后,通过FineBI的数据处理功能,将原始数据进行清洗、转换和聚合,形成符合分析需求的数据结构。接着,通过FineBI的数据可视化功能,创建各种图表和仪表盘,展示各项财务数据和指标。例如,可以创建一个实时监控仪表盘,实时监控企业的现金流、应收账款、应付账款等关键财务指标。最后,通过FineBI的自动化分析功能,进行异常检测、趋势预测等自动化分析,发现数据背后的趋势和问题,为企业的财务决策提供参考。
通过FineBI,企业可以实现全面的财务分析,提高财务管理水平和决策能力。FineBI强大的数据采集、数据处理、数据可视化和自动化分析功能,为企业的财务分析提供了有力的支持。
七、总结
财务分析使用软件开发的关键在于数据采集、数据处理、数据可视化和自动化分析。FineBI作为帆软旗下的专业BI工具,提供了强大的数据采集、数据处理、数据可视化和自动化分析功能,帮助企业实现全面的财务分析,提高财务管理水平和决策能力。通过FineBI,企业可以轻松进行预算管理、成本控制、盈利分析和风险管理等各种财务分析应用场景,提高财务管理的效率和准确性。FineBI官网: https://s.fanruan.com/f459r;
相关问答FAQs:
财务分析怎么使用软件开发
在现代商业环境中,财务分析的准确性和效率对于企业的成功至关重要。随着科技的进步,越来越多的企业开始利用软件开发来提升财务分析的能力。本文将探讨如何通过软件开发来实现财务分析的最佳实践,帮助企业在这个竞争激烈的市场中立于不败之地。
一、财务分析的基本概念
财务分析是指通过对财务报表和其他相关信息的分析,评估企业的财务状况和经营成果。它包括对资产负债表、利润表和现金流量表的深入分析,帮助管理层和利益相关者做出明智的决策。
二、软件开发在财务分析中的重要性
1. 提高数据处理效率
在传统的财务分析中,数据的收集和处理往往耗费大量时间和人力资源。通过软件开发,企业可以构建自动化的数据处理系统,减少人工干预,提高数据处理的效率。比如,使用Python等编程语言,可以轻松实现数据的导入、清洗和转换,快速生成所需的财务报告。
2. 实现实时数据分析
现代企业需要实时获取财务数据以便做出快速反应。通过建立基于云计算的财务分析软件,企业可以实现数据的实时更新和共享。这样一来,管理层可以随时查看财务状况,及时调整策略。
3. 提高分析的准确性
手动财务分析容易出现人为错误,而软件开发可以通过算法和模型来提高分析的准确性。通过机器学习和数据挖掘技术,企业能够识别出潜在的财务风险,并做出相应的预警。
三、如何开发财务分析软件
1. 确定需求
在开发任何软件之前,首先需要明确企业的需求。这包括需要分析的数据类型、分析的深度、生成的报告格式等。在与财务团队和管理层沟通后,制定出详细的需求文档,以便后续开发。
2. 选择合适的技术栈
根据需求,选择合适的技术栈进行开发。常见的技术栈包括前端框架(如React、Angular)、后端框架(如Django、Flask)以及数据库(如MySQL、PostgreSQL)。选择合适的工具将有助于提升软件的性能和用户体验。
3. 数据集成
财务分析需要多个数据源的支持。企业应考虑如何集成不同系统中的数据,比如ERP、CRM等。通过API接口或数据仓库的方式,可以实现数据的集中管理和分析。
4. 开发数据可视化功能
数据可视化在财务分析中扮演着重要角色。通过图表和仪表盘,将复杂的数据以直观的方式呈现,帮助用户快速理解和分析数据。开发时可以使用如D3.js、Chart.js等可视化库,提升用户体验。
5. 测试与迭代
软件开发是一个持续迭代的过程。在开发完成后,需要进行充分的测试,确保软件的稳定性和可靠性。同时,根据用户的反馈,持续优化软件功能和用户界面。
四、财务分析软件的应用场景
1. 预算管理
企业可以利用财务分析软件进行预算编制和执行监控。通过分析历史数据,软件可以帮助企业制定合理的预算,并实时跟踪预算执行情况,及时发现偏差并进行调整。
2. 成本分析
成本控制是企业盈利的重要一环。通过财务分析软件,企业可以深入分析各项成本的构成,识别出高成本区域,并提出优化建议,从而提高整体盈利能力。
3. 财务预测
通过历史数据的分析和趋势预测,财务分析软件可以帮助企业进行未来财务状况的预测。这对于企业制定长期战略和投资决策具有重要意义。
4. 风险管理
企业面临的财务风险多种多样,包括流动性风险、信用风险等。通过财务分析软件,企业可以实时监控财务指标,及时识别潜在风险并采取应对措施。
五、选择财务分析软件时的考虑因素
1. 易用性
软件的用户界面应简洁明了,便于用户快速上手。财务人员不一定具备深厚的技术背景,因此软件的易用性至关重要。
2. 功能完备性
选择软件时应考虑其功能的全面性,包括数据导入、处理、分析和报告生成等。功能越全面,企业在财务分析方面的灵活性就越大。
3. 安全性
财务数据的安全性十分重要,企业应选择具备良好安全机制的软件,确保数据在存储和传输过程中的安全性。
4. 技术支持
在使用软件的过程中,技术支持也是一个重要因素。企业应选择能够提供及时技术支持的供应商,以便在遇到问题时能够快速解决。
六、总结
财务分析在企业管理中占据着重要地位,而软件开发则为财务分析的高效性和准确性提供了强有力的支持。通过合理的需求分析、技术选择和功能开发,企业能够打造出符合自身需求的财务分析软件,从而提升财务决策的科学性和有效性。随着技术的不断进步,未来的财务分析将更加智能化和自动化,为企业的发展提供更强大的动力。
FAQs
1. 使用财务分析软件有哪些优势?
使用财务分析软件的优势主要体现在提高效率、降低错误率、实时数据更新、增强数据可视化等方面。通过自动化的数据处理,企业能够节省大量的人力资源,快速生成所需的财务报告。同时,软件提供的可视化功能可以帮助管理层更好地理解复杂的财务数据,从而做出更明智的决策。
2. 如何确保财务分析软件的安全性?
确保财务分析软件的安全性可以从多个方面入手。首先,选择信誉良好的软件供应商,其产品应具备数据加密、权限控制等安全功能。其次,定期进行安全审计和漏洞扫描,及时修复可能存在的安全隐患。此外,企业内部也应制定严格的数据访问权限管理制度,确保只有授权人员才能访问敏感的财务数据。
3. 财务分析软件可以与哪些系统集成?
财务分析软件通常可以与多个系统进行集成,如企业资源规划(ERP)系统、客户关系管理(CRM)系统、电子表格(如Excel)以及其他业务管理软件。通过API接口或数据仓库的方式,企业可以实现不同系统之间的数据共享与协作,提高财务分析的全面性和准确性。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



